The chemical class of AGR2 activators includes a variety of compounds that indirectly influence the expression or activity of AGR2, primarily through their impact on endoplasmic reticulum (ER) stress and protein folding pathways. This class features agents like tunicamycin, thapsigargin, and DTT, known to induce ER stress, a condition that can upregulate AGR2 expression as the protein plays a role in the unfolded protein response. Such chemicals activate a cellular adaptive mechanism to cope with increased protein misfolding, thereby potentially enhancing AGR2 activity.
Compounds that disrupt normal cellular processes, such as Brefeldin A and chloroquine, also form a significant part of this class. By interfering with ER-Golgi transport and lysosomal function, respectively, these chemicals can create a cellular environment that necessitates increased expression of AGR2 as part of the response to protein folding disruptions and stress. Additionally, inhibitors of molecular chaperones and protein degradation pathways, such as 17-AAG and MG-132, highlight another aspect of this class. By inhibiting Hsp90 and the proteasome, these compounds can lead to the accumulation of misfolded proteins, thus potentially triggering an increase in AGR2 expression. Furthermore, natural compounds like celastrol and curcumin, known for their broad effects on cellular stress responses, contribute to this class by inducing mechanisms that can upregulate AGR2. Celastrol's ability to induce the heat shock response and curcumin's impact on various cell stress pathways exemplify the diverse mechanisms through which these activators can indirectly enhance AGR2 expression. Beta-mercaptoethanol, another member of this class, exemplifies the role of oxidative stress in modulating AGR2 activity.
